SYDNEY — Australia is now the primary nation to permit psychiatrists to prescribe sure psychedelic substances to sufferers with melancholy or post-traumatic stress dysfunction.

Read more

Beginning Saturday, Australian physicians can prescribe doses of MDMA, also called ecstasy, for PTSD. Psilocybin, the psychoactive ingredient in psychedelic mushrooms, will be given to individuals who have hard-to-treat melancholy. The nation put the 2 medicine on the listing of accredited medicines by the Therapeutic Goods Administration.

Scientists in Australia have been stunned by the transfer, which was introduced in February however took impact July 1. One scientist stated it places Australia “at the forefront of research in this field.”

The rising cultural acceptance has led two U.S. states to approve measures for his or her use: Oregon was the primary to legalize the grownup use of psilocybin, and Colorado’s voters decriminalized psilocybin in 2022. The U.S. Food and Drug Administration designated psilocybin as a “breakthrough therapy” in 2018, a label that’s designed to hurry the event and evaluate of medicine to deal with a severe situation. Psychedelics researchers have benefited from federal grants, together with Johns Hopkins, and the FDA launched draft steerage late final month for researchers designing medical trials testing psychedelic medicine as potential therapies for a wide range of medical situations.

Still, the American Psychiatric Association has not endorsed using psychedelics in remedy, noting the FDA has but to supply a last dedication.

And medical specialists within the U.S. and elsewhere, Australia included, have cautioned that extra analysis is required on the medicine’ efficacy and the extent of the dangers of psychedelics, which may trigger hallucinations.

“There are concerns that evidence remains inadequate and moving to clinical service is premature; that incompetent or poorly equipped clinicians could flood the space; that treatment will be unaffordable for most; that formal oversight of training, treatment, and patient outcomes will be minimal or ill-informed,” stated Dr. Paul Liknaitzky, head of Monash University’s Clinical Psychedelic Lab.

Plus, the medicine will probably be costly in Australia - about $10,000 (roughly $6,600 U.S. {dollars}) per affected person for remedy.
